Our joint petition with Vegan Food UK has amassed more than 25,000 signatures.
This is a fantastic achievement over such a short period of time, and shows that there is a demand for more vegan food on the high street and indeed vegan cheese at Papa John’s.
Veganism is continuing to grow, mainly out of an increasing concern for animal welfare and the environment. As such, companies need to take heed of such trends and introduce more vegan options, or face being left behind.
Papa John’s is one of the only major pizza chain to not offer a vegan cheese alternative, despite being very vegan friendly with their bases and sauces. It is time for them to up their vegan game, and there has never been a better time to do it.
Papa John’s have told us that they are currently ‘reviewing the options that would answer the needs of vegans to [their] menu’, so it is vital that we continue to let them know that there is a demand for more plant-based options.
